Associate Producer: Tall Tree Productions
Director and Musical Staging: Lynne Taylor-Corbett
Book: Lynne Taylor-Corbett and Shaun Taylor-Corbett
Music and Lyrics: Shaun Taylor-Corbett and Chris Wiseman
Additional Music and Lyrics: Michael Moricz and Robert Lindsey-Nassif
Music Supervisor: Michael Moricz
Music Director: James Woods
Cultural Consultant: Blackfeet Knowledge Carriers and Brent Florendo Sitwall Apum (Wasco, Yakama, Warm Springs)
Casting: Stephanie Klapper Casting
SEEKING:
DOROTHY DARK EYES (Woman, 35-40, Native American, First Nations, Mixed Race Native/Indigenous) Darrell's childhood friend, now a devoted tribal teacher who runs the Tall Tree language immersion School. Rich pop voice, Mezzo.
BETTY STILL SMOKING (Woman, late 50s-Early 60s, Native American, First Nations, Mixed Race Native/Indigenous) A matriarchal pillar of the tribe with a great sense of humor. Legit Alto with Belt.
AIYANA BUCK (Girl, 16, Native American, First Nations, Mixed Race Native/Indigenous) Sheriff Buck's rebellious 16-year-old daughter who is the ringleader in the effort to get Tonto and Smudge to run away from the res with her. Doubles ENSEMBLE roles. Pop-Rock Alto.
SMUDGE (Boy, 13-14, Native American, First Nations, Mixed Race Native/Indigenous) Small in stature as he doubles as YOUNG DARRELL, a Fancy Dancer, in flashbacks. Smudge is a neglected kid - a follower - who tags along with Aiyana. Pop Tenor.
SHERIFF RAYMOND BUCK (Man, Late 30s-Early 40s, Native American, First Nations, Mixed Race Native/Indigenous) The tribal Sheriff and DARRELL'S contemporary. A dangerous man desperate for respect. He is bitter that Darrell’s father, White Feather, was a champion lacrosse player who always
bested his own father. Darrell returning is a thorn in his side. Doubles as BILLY, the food vendor, in Indian Days. Baritone, sings a sustained vocable solo.
GRANDMA JINGLE DRESS (Woman, Late 60s-70s, Native American, First Nations, Mixed Race Native/Indigenous) The elder tribal storyteller, a savant. Powwow and Ensemble singing.
SAM SILVER (Man, Late 30s-Early 40s, Native American, First Nations, Mixed Race Native/Indigenous) The Bureau of Indian Affairs Official, self-important, self-serving in the name of the tribe. His years in that position have skewed him to the ways of the white world. Doubles as HECTOR, a gender fluid friend of Roberta and Betty. He channels BLACK ELK in “Pick Up the Pieces.” Pop Rock Tenor with legit capability.
NATIVE MUSICIAN SINGER-DANCER (Man, 20s-40s, Native American, First Nations, Mixed Race Native/Indigenous) Athletic, theatrical experience a plus. Powwow singing. May also double as SAM SILVER and HECTOR.
